    Insidious: Out of the Further—What the New Chapter Adds to the Horror Franchise

For horror fans, however, few concepts have remained as recognizable as Insidious and its mysterious supernatural realm, The Further.

    After Insidious: The Red Door brought the Lambert family’s story to another chapter in 2023, Insidious: Out of the Further takes the franchise in a new direction with a different family, a new threat, and a more profound look at what The Further can do.

    Released in August 2026, the sixth installment is directed by Jacob Chase and stars Amelia Eve as Gemma, a young mother who discovers that she can enter The Further. Lin Shaye also returns as Elise Rainier, connecting the new story to the mythology established by the earlier films.

    A New Family at the Center

    Out of the Further has taken a big new direction. The action does not now center on the Lamberts, although they will always be involved in the franchise. The film now follows Gemma and her daughter as they fight against events tied to Gemma’s powers. However, the shift allows for the story to explore the events of the franchise through the fresh characters of Gemma and her daughter.

    This new story is significant because it enables the film to function as a separate narrative while also contributing to world-building.

    The Further Becomes More Dangerous

    The Further is undoubtedly a major component of Insidious. It is portrayed as a mysterious dimension inhabited by lost souls and malevolent beings and where normal laws of our world may not apply.

    Out of the Further is based on this notion and gives Gemma a unique power to travel to The Further and bring things back into the real world.

    This small aspect alters the ballgame.

    Older movies of the Insidious franchise tackled the themes of entities coming into our world. In this case, the connection between the characters and the supernatural elements creates a sense of confusion. The Further is no longer just a scary place; its effects can eventually follow the characters back into the real world.

    Elise Rainier Remains an Important Link

    Although the film features new personalities, Lin Shaye’s comeback as Elise Rainier offers long-time fans a sense of recognition. Having established herself as one of the most recognizable figures of the series, Elise has played the role of a paranormal investigator, leading fans through the enigma of the Further. Thus, Elise acts as a link between the old mythology and the new plotlines.

    Elise’s arrival reminds fans that although Insidious may specialize in stories involving new characters and settings, it does not mean it will entirely ignore its established world.

    A Different Kind of Franchise Expansion

    Instead of just adding in a follow-up story to what is already known about the Lambert family, Out of the Further shows how the Insidious idea can be applied using entirely new actors.

    This may eventually turn out to be one of the key innovations of the franchise. Because The Further potential allows for more than just one story, while the rules of the supernatural world make it easy to link all the stories together.

    The use of this approach opens up opportunities for the series to explore other types of horror. The abilities of Gemma lead to a disturbing question posed by the film: what will happen if someone can enter the world of spirits while those spirits can enter the world of the living?

    Keeping the Core of Insidious Intact

    Out of the Further remains true to the Insidious franchise, despite the addition of a new family and an expanded mythology. The supernatural environment, The Further, the demonic creatures, and Elise Rainier share traits with the previous films.

    However, the introduction of new characters and the main plot of the film mean that it does not completely rely on the Lambert story. A crucial aspect for a long-running horror franchise is balancing the old with the new.

    The new movies must introduce just the right amount of familiar elements to keep established fans happy while also incorporating fresh ideas to ensure the series remains interesting.

    What Comes Next for Insidious?

    Out of the Further offers the franchise a fresh opportunity to introduce new elements to the story that originally attracted audiences to The Further.

    However, it is still unclear whether this move will result in future stories. Despite that, the supernatural world of Insidious will still have various opportunities to introduce new characters and rules and bring more fears into other viewers’ lives.

    Fans of the franchise who have followed it since the 2010 release will see that Out of the Further is more than just another ghost and demon encounter; it shows how far the story can go without the Lambert family.
